Introduction: What Are Stablecoins?

In the ever-evolving world of cryptocurrency, stablecoins have emerged as a powerful financial tool. Unlike traditional cryptocurrencies such as Bitcoin and Ethereum, which are known for their price volatility, stablecoins are designed to maintain a stable value by pegging their price to a reserve asset like the U.S. dollar, euro, or even gold. These digital assets serve as a bridge between the conventional financial system (fiat currencies) and the decentralized world of blockchain.


Stablecoins aim to combine the best of both worlds: the stability of fiat currencies and the efficiency and speed of blockchain transactions. As a result, they have gained immense popularity among traders, investors, and financial institutions.


The Evolution of Digital Currency

From Volatility to Stability

Bitcoin, the first and most prominent cryptocurrency, was launched in 2009 as a decentralized alternative to fiat currency. However, its wild price fluctuations made it unsuitable for daily transactions. This created a demand for a more stable digital asset—thus, the concept of stablecoins was born.


Milestones in Stablecoin Development

2014: Tether (USDT), the first stablecoin, was introduced, pegged to the U.S. dollar.

2018–2020: The rise of competing stablecoins like USD Coin (USDC), DAI, and Binance USD (BUSD).

2021 onwards: Stablecoins gained attention from regulators and central banks as they became key players in decentralized finance (DeFi).


How Do Stablecoins Work?

Pegging Mechanisms

Stablecoins are typically backed or pegged to real-world assets using different mechanisms:

Fiat-Collateralized: Backed by reserves of fiat currency held in banks. (e.g., USDT, USDC)

Crypto-Collateralized: Backed by other cryptocurrencies, often over-collateralized to manage volatility. (e.g., DAI)

Algorithmic: Maintain their peg through smart contracts and supply-demand algorithms. (e.g., TerraUSD before its collapse)


Issuance and Redemption

Most fiat-backed stablecoins operate by allowing users to deposit fiat currency in exchange for stablecoins, which can be redeemed back at a 1:1 ratio. Issuers maintain transparency by conducting regular audits and publishing reserve data.


Types of Stablecoins

1. Fiat-Collateralized Stablecoins

These are the most common and trusted stablecoins. Backed by a 1:1 reserve in a bank account, they offer high price stability. Examples include:


Tether (USDT)

USD Coin (USDC)

Binance USD (BUSD)


2. Crypto-Collateralized Stablecoins

These stablecoins are backed by cryptocurrencies such as Ethereum. To compensate for crypto volatility, they are often over-collateralized. For example:

DAI by MakerDAO is backed by Ethereum and other assets.

sUSD by Synthetix.


3. Algorithmic Stablecoins

These are governed by smart contracts that automatically expand or reduce supply to stabilize prices. However, they are more prone to failure, as seen with:

TerraUSD (UST), which collapsed in 2022.

Ampleforth (AMPL), which uses rebasing to adjust supply.


4. Commodity-Backed Stablecoins

Backed by physical assets like gold or oil, these stablecoins allow users to invest in commodities with digital convenience.

Paxos Gold (PAXG)

Tether Gold (XAUT)


Why Stablecoins Matter

Financial Stability in Crypto Markets

Stablecoins provide a safe haven during market volatility. Investors often convert their crypto assets into stablecoins to lock in value without exiting the blockchain ecosystem.


Enabling Cross-Border Payments

With near-instant transactions and lower fees, stablecoins are revolutionizing international payments. They bypass traditional banking systems and reduce delays associated with wire transfers.


Facilitating DeFi Ecosystems

In the decentralized finance (DeFi) world, stablecoins are used for lending, borrowing, and earning interest. They play a crucial role in liquidity pools, staking, and yield farming.


Enhancing Accessibility

For individuals in countries with unstable currencies or limited banking access, stablecoins offer a more reliable and accessible store of value and medium of exchange.

Risks and Challenges

1. Regulatory Uncertainty

Governments and financial regulators are increasingly scrutinizing stablecoins due to concerns over money laundering, consumer protection, and financial stability.


2. Centralization and Trust Issues

Fiat-backed stablecoins often rely on centralized entities to manage reserves. Lack of transparency or mismanagement could lead to loss of trust.


3. Smart Contract Vulnerabilities

Algorithmic and crypto-backed stablecoins depend on smart contracts, which may be vulnerable to bugs or attacks if not properly audited.


4. Depegging Risks

When a stablecoin loses its peg (like UST), it can cause widespread panic and damage the broader crypto ecosystem.


The Role of Central Bank Digital Currencies (CBDCs)

Are CBDCs a Threat to Stablecoins?

Central banks around the world are developing CBDCs—digital versions of fiat currencies. While CBDCs are government-backed, they may compete directly with stablecoins in future financial systems.


Coexistence or Competition?

Experts predict a dual system where CBDCs and private stablecoins coexist. Stablecoins may focus on innovation, while CBDCs bring regulatory backing and stability.


The Future of Stablecoins

Mainstream Adoption

With growing institutional interest, stablecoins are likely to become integral to financial systems. Major payment providers like PayPal and Visa already support stablecoin transactions.


Integration with Web3

Stablecoins will play a central role in Web3 applications, including decentralized apps (dApps), digital identity, and tokenized assets.


Enhanced Regulation and Transparency

Expect stricter regulations on reserve management, audits, and operational clarity. While this may limit some innovations, it will increase user trust.


Use Cases of Stablecoins

1. Trading and Arbitrage

Traders use stablecoins to quickly move funds between exchanges, take advantage of arbitrage opportunities, and reduce risk exposure.


2. Remittances

Stablecoins can dramatically reduce fees and delays in sending money across borders, benefiting millions of unbanked and underbanked individuals.


3. Payroll and Gig Economy

Some companies now pay freelancers and gig workers in stablecoins, offering instant access to global payments without banking barriers.


4. E-Commerce and Digital Payments

Merchants can accept stablecoins without worrying about volatility, making them ideal for online transactions and recurring payments.
